Pandas. Tratando de filas de eliminación en condiciones pero el código reemplaza columna con otra columna

vadk01:

Así que en un principio me da un vistazo por encima de mi db.

print(sales.head)
print(sales['SALE PRICE'].describe())

Después de que yo uso un truco para mantener las filas que no contienen este tipo de valor NULL

sales['SALE PRICE'] = sales[sales['SALE PRICE'] != ' -  ']

Después de que el cheque que si todo se hace Wright

print(sales.head)
print(sales['SALE PRICE'].describe())

Pero mi programa simplemente se cambia la columna PRECIO DE VENTA con columna 0 que contiene índices Alguna idea?

Fojn:

Sólo tiene que volver a asignar resultado salesen lugar de la columna.

sales = sales[sales['SALE PRICE'] != ' -  ']
  • sales['SALE PRICE'] != ' - 'Esto devolverá índices con Truey FalseValores.
  • Así sales[sales['SALE PRICE'] != ' - ']Esto ya devuelve una trama de datos que quiere.

Supongo que te gusta

Origin http://10.200.1.11:23101/article/api/json?id=383698&siteId=1
Recomendado
Clasificación